REFPROP V6.0NIST Thermodynamic and Transport
Properties of Refrigerants and Refrigerant
Mixtures Database
  • Includes 33 pure fluids and mixtures with up to 5
    components
  • including R23, R32, R125, R134a, R143a, R245fa,
    R22, R123, R124, R141b, R142b, R11, R12, R13,
    R113, R114, R115, CO2, ammonia, propane,
    isobutane, R407C, R410A
  • Uses the most accurate pure fluid equations of
    state currently available also has new mixture
    model with experimentally based values of mixture
    parameters for 75 mixtures.
  • Provides both equilibrium and transport
    properties including P, V, T, density, Cp, Cv,
    enthalpy, entropy, speed of sound, thermal
    conductivity, viscosity and surface tension.
  • Uses a new, graphical user interface with on-line
    help, plots of properties, and a wide variety of
    tables.
  • FORTRAN Source code for property routines is
    provided.

NIST/ASME Steam Properties Database V2.1
  • Based on the new International Association for
    the Properties of Water and Steam (IAPWS)
    formulation.
  • Many thermophysical properties are available
    including
  • T, P, V, Density, quality, enthalpy, internal
    energy, entropy, Cv, Cp, Helmholtz energy, Gibbs
    energy, fugacity, isothermal compressibility,
    volume expansivity, speed of sound, Joule-Thomson
    coefficient, thermal conductivity, viscosity,
    dielectric constant, and surface tension.
  • Uses a new, graphical user interface with on-line
    help plots of properties, and a wide variety of
    tables.
  • FORTRAN source code is provided for property
    subroutines.

NIST Mixture Property DatabaseNIST14, V9.08
  • Provides thermodynamic and transport properties
    of pure fluids and their mixtures with an
    emphasis on validated density calculations,
    especially for CO2-rich hydrocarbon mixtures.
    Each pure fluid is computed using high accuracy
    equations of state. Mixtures use an extended
    corresponding states model with exact shape
    factors. 17 pure fluids are available including
  • methane, ethane, propane, iso and normal butane,
    iso and normal pentane, n-hexane, n-heptane,
    nitrogen, oxygen, argon, carbon monoxide, carbon
    dioxide, hydrogen sulfide.
  • Many properties are available
  • Phase equilibrium calculations bubble point
    pressure and temperature, dew point pressure and
    temperature.
  • saturation properties, P, V, T, density,
    enthalpy, Cp, entropy, viscosity and thermal
    conductivity.
  • Isothermal flash calculations tables of density,
    enthalpy, entropy and heat capacity as functions
    of T or P.

NIST Thermophysical Properties of Hydrocarbon
Mixtures Database(SUPERTRAPP) NIST4 v2.0
  • Program provides thermophysical properties of
    pure fluids and hydrocarbon mixtures with an
    emphasis on prediction, for a large number of
    fluids.
  • 192 pure fluids available alkanes from methane
    to C26, alkenes, cycloalkanes, aromatics,
    napthenic compounds.
  • Users may input their own new fluids, by
    inputting molecular weight, critical properties
    and normal boiling point.
  • Many properties are available
  • Phase equilibrium calculations bubble point
    pressure and temperature, dew point pressure and
    temperature.
  • Saturation properties, P,V, T, density, enthalpy,
    Cp, entropy, viscosity and thermal conductivity.
  • Isothermal flash calculations tables of density,
    enthalpy, entropy and heat capacity as functions
    of T or P.
  • Adiabatic flash calculations, isentropic flash
    calculations.
  • FORTRAN source code is available for property
    subroutines.

NIST Thermophysical Properties of Pure Fluids
DatabaseNIST12 V3.0
  • Provides equilibrium thermodynamic properties and
    transport properties using wide ranging NIST
    Standard Reference correlations including
  • P,V,T, density, Cp, Cv, speed of sound,
    enthalpy, entropy, thermal conductivity,
    viscosity, Gruneisen parameter, Joule-Thomson
    coefficient, Prandtl number, dielectric
    constant, thermal diffusivity, compressibility
    factor.
  • 17 pure fluids available
  • argon, iso-butane, n-butane, carbon dioxide,
    carbon monoxide, deuterium, ethane, ethylene,
    helium (including superfluid states), normal
    hydrogen, para hydrogen, methane, nitrogen,
    nitrogen trifluoride, oxygen, propane, and xenon.
  • FORTRAN source code is provided for property
    routines.

NIST Database 72Thermophysical Properties of Air
and Air Component MixturesAIRPROPS
  • Provides thermophysical properties of standard
    air and mixtures of nitrogen-argon-oxygen.
  • Properties include P, V, T, density, enthalpy,
    entropy, internal energy, Gibbs energy,
    Helmholtz energy, Cp, Cv, speed of sound, thermal
    conductivity, viscosity, compressibility factor,
    virial coefficients, fugacity coefficient,
    surface tension, Joule-Thomson coefficient,
    adiabatic compressibility, adiabatic bulk
    modulus, isothermal compressibility, isothermal
    bulk modulus, volume expansivity
  • Equation of state is valid from the triple point
    to 870K and up to 70MPa
  • Dew and bubble point pressures, and the pressure
    along the freezing line may be calculated.
  • FORTRAN source code is available for property
    subroutines.
